The Rocca di Ravaldino in Forlì

The imposing Rocca di Ravaldino was built during the fourteenth century and extended in the fifteenth. It has a square plan and cylindrical towers. It was the theatre of a siege by Cesare Borgia who took it in 1500. In the late nineteenth century it was transformed into a prison.
